Headstone Lane Station stands equipped to meet many of your travel requirements, combining essential services with user-friendly facilities. Passengers can acquire tickets from the ticket machine on site, which also supports collection for those pre-purchased online. For accessibility, the station offers an induction loop system and step-free access, though exclusively on the northbound platform. It's worth noting that while steps free travel is facilitated here, the absence of wa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shment facilities necessitates a bit of planning ahead for extended waits.
The station doesn’t operate with ticket barriers which facilitates easy movement, and assistance for travelers with reduced mobility can be arranged by contacting the staff in advance or booking through the Passenger Assist service. While there is no dedicated parking availability or taxi rank, there is a provision for securing bicycles, making cycling a viable transit option here.
Ease of transition to other modes of travel can make or break a journey, and Headstone Lane Station offers well-connected links. Travelers can continue their journey via bus services, accessible from nearby stops on Long Elmes road. For those seeking the London Underground experience, Harrow & Wealdstone station is just a quick three-minute train ride away, providing further access to the region's expansive tube network. Marsh Barton is equipped with several facilities designed to make travel as smooth as possible, although the lack of a ticket office may surprise some travelers. Fear not, because ticket machines are available,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online with ease. The station has accessible ticket machines and is designed as a step-free facility, ensuring accommodation for all passengers. While there's no staff assistance available on-site, help points provide essential information when needed.
One thing to note, especially for families or those looking to refresh during their journey, is the absence of public restrooms, refreshment stands, shops, and ATMs. As such, planning a stop at a local facility before your journey might be wise. Fortunately, the station does offer "GWR Free Station WiFi" for those needing to stay connected.
Marsh Barton Train Station links seamlessly with local transport networks to ensure you can easily reach your final destination. Rail replacement bus services and regular bus services operate from Grace Road Central, giving you plenty of options if your journey requires further travel. However, accessible taxis aren’t available directly at the station, so pre-booking a car service might be necessary if you require additional support.
